With its beautiful styling and advanced engineering, the Carver 53 Voyager represents the perfect blending of art and science - the meticulous attention of traditional craftsmanship combined with the latest innovative technologies. Topside, there's fun and comfort for everyone aboard. The flybridge offers a large dinette / lounge, seating for eight and a wet bar, plus afterdeck storage for a dinghy. A large sliding door leads from the cockpit to the luxurious cabin where frameless windows enhance light and visibility. The interior offers a salon with a lot of counter space and storage, island style top with stools, and comfortable sleeping quarters with private heads.
